'use strict';
 
// MODULES //
 
var isnan = require( '@stdlib/math/base/assert/is-nan' );
var mrange = require( '@stdlib/stats/incr/mrange' );
 
 
// MAIN //
 
/**
* Returns an accumulator function which incrementally computes a moving range, ignoring `NaN` values.
*
* @param {PositiveInteger} W - window size
* @throws {TypeError} must provide a positive integer
* @returns {Function} accumulator function
*
* @example
* var accumulator = incrnanmrange( 3 );
*
* var r = accumulator();
* // returns null
*
* r = accumulator( 2.0 );
* // returns 0.0
*
* r = accumulator( -5.0 );
* // returns 7.0
*
* r = accumulator( NaN );
* // returns 7.0
*
* r = accumulator( 3.0 );
* // returns 8.0
*
* r = accumulator( 5.0 );
* // returns 10.0
*
* r = accumulator();
* // returns 10.0
*/
function incrnanmrange( W ) {
	var acc = mrange( W );
	return accumulator;
 
	/**
	* If provided a value, the accumulator function returns an updated range. If not provided a value, the accumulator function returns the current range.
	*
	* @private
	* @param {number} [x] - new value
	* @returns {(number|null)} range or null
	*/
	function accumulator( x ) {
		if ( arguments.length === 0 || isnan( x ) ) {
			return acc();
		}
		return acc( x );
	}
}
 
 
// EXPORTS //
 
module.exports = incrnanmrange;
